This study analyzes the short story “Robohnya Surau Kami” (The Collapse of Our Mosque) by A. A. Navis through Jacques Derrida’s deconstruction approach. The research aims to dismantle the dominant meanings constructed in the text, especially those related to the binary opposition between ritual religiosity and social responsibility. Using a qualitative-descriptive method, the study applies a textual deconstruction process that includes identifying binary oppositions, reversing their hierarchy, and revealing contradictions and ironies embedded in the narrative. The findings show that Navis’s story reverses the hierarchy of values in which pious worship, often seen as the highest form of morality, becomes a symbol of spiritual egoism and social neglect. This reversal produces new meanings of religiosity as a moral awareness that must be continuously negotiated in social life. Thus, “Robohnya Surau Kami” not only criticizes formalistic piety but also opens a plural and dynamic space of interpretation that challenges absolute moral assumptions in modern society.
